A Moment of Serenity Captured in Light

In the quietude of 1893, Santiago Rusiñol prats captured a scene that transcends mere architecture, inviting the viewer into a world of profound stillness. White Gallery is not simply a depiction of a building; it is an atmospheric meditation on light and solitude. The painting presents a pristine white structure, its surfaces catching the soft glow of an unseen sun, anchored by a rustic brick walkway that leads the eye toward the heart of the composition. As one gazes upon this work, the presence of a solitary figure near the center suggests a narrative of quiet contemplation, perhaps a moment of waiting or a brief pause in a journey through a sun-drenched landscape. The delicate inclusion of a bird perched high upon a branch adds a touch of life to the stillness, reminding us of the gentle pulse of nature that exists even in our most private moments of reflection.

The technique employed by Rusiñol reflects his mastery of the Catalan Modernisme movement, where the boundaries between Impressionism and Symbolism begin to blur. Through a delicate application of paint, he achieves a luminous quality that makes the white walls appear almost translucent, as if they are breathing with the surrounding environment. The interplay between the structured geometry of the building and the organic, soft textures of the background trees creates a balanced tension, characteristic of his ability to find harmony in the natural world. Historical Resonance and Artistic Legacy

To understand White Gallery is to understand the spirit of late 19th-century Spain. Santiago Rusiñol was a pioneer of the Modernisme movement, a period marked by an intense search for identity and beauty through the lens of modern life. This work serves as a window into that era, embodying the era's fascination with light, atmosphere, and the poetic potential of the landscape. Rusiñol’s ability to infuse a simple architectural scene with such emotional depth was a precursor to the more radical shifts in art that would later follow, even influencing giants like Picasso. Об этом произведении

Основные сведения

  • Title: White gallery
  • Artistic style: Impressionism and Symbolism
  • Dimensions: 62 x 90 cm
  • Subject or theme: Serene outdoor scene with building and person
  • Year: 1893
